How to Create Engaging Safety Training Videos

Creating engaging safety training videos is an important part of any workplace safety program. By providing employees with visual and interactive learning materials, employers can ensure that their staff is well-informed and up-to-date on the latest safety protocols. Here are some tips for creating effective safety training videos:

1. Keep it Short and Simple: Safety training videos should be concise and to the point. Aim to keep the video under 10 minutes in length and focus on the most important safety topics.

2. Use Visuals: Visuals are a great way to engage viewers and help them retain information. Use images, diagrams, and animations to illustrate key points and make the video more interesting.

3. Include Real-Life Examples: Showing real-life examples of safety protocols in action can help viewers better understand the importance of following safety guidelines.

4. Make it Interactive: Incorporate interactive elements such as quizzes and polls to keep viewers engaged and ensure they are absorbing the information.

5. Use Professional Voiceover: Professional voiceover can help make the video more engaging and ensure that the information is presented in a clear and concise manner.

By following these tips, employers can create effective safety training videos that will help ensure their staff is well-informed and up-to-date on the latest safety protocols.
